It is estimated that the incidence of tinnitus is relatively high, about 10% – 15%. It can be seen that the number of people affected by tinnitus in the world is wide. However, there are different opinions about tinnitus among the people, so what is the truth?

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Misunderstanding 1. Tinnitus is an incurable disease

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Tinnitus itself is not a disease, but a result of various potential diseases reacting on the ear. It is a symptom. Tinnitus can be caused by noise, nerve damage, vascular disease, and even traumatic brain injury. Tinnitus may also be caused by adverse reactions after taking certain drugs.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Although there is no absolute “cure method” for tinnitus, there are still some ways to reduce symptoms and make tinnitus patients more easily accept the existence of tinnitus.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Mistake 2: changing eating habits can eliminate tinnitus

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Some people think that the consumption of alcohol, coffee or high salt food, as well as food additives will aggravate tinnitus, but usually these are not the root causes.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Balanced diet, exercise and healthy lifestyle are very important to the overall health. It can improve immunity to a certain extent or reduce tinnitus, but it is not the way to treat tinnitus, and it is impossible to “cure” tinnitus.

Misunderstanding 3. Once there is tinnitus, we can do nothing

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Don’t be so pessimistic! Scientists have never stopped studying tinnitus, and treatment methods are constantly improving and improving.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Whether your tinnitus is mild or severe, the doctor will give you a treatment plan to help you alleviate the symptoms. In addition, doctors can also reduce the possibility of tinnitus through comprehensive diagnosis and treatment of diseases that may cause tinnitus.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
4. Only hearing impaired people have tinnitus

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Most people with hearing loss will have tinnitus. Hearing loss and tinnitus often go together. But be aware that people with normal hearing may also have tinnitus. For example, when you are in a high-intensity noise environment, such as a rock concert, you are likely to experience temporary tinnitus. In this case, it is urgent to keep away from the noise and keep the ears quiet.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
If tinnitus does not disappear in the next few days, it is recommended to go to the otorhinolaryngology Department of the regular hospital to see a doctor, so as to avoid worsening tinnitus, or even hearing loss.

5. People with tinnitus will eventually become deaf

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Although hearing loss and tinnitus are “closely related”, they can exist alone, not necessarily in one way or another. Therefore, having tinnitus does not mean that there will be hearing loss. Even if the hearing loss occurs after tinnitus, it does not mean that there will be complete deafness in the end.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
It is suggested to wear suitable hearing aids in time, which can not only compensate for hearing loss, but also reduce tinnitus.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Misunderstanding 6. Tinnitus sounds like a sound

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Tinnitus sounds vary from person to person. It can be said that every tinnitus patient hears different tinnitus sounds. High frequency buzzing like ringing tone is common in tinnitus patients, but some people will hear such sounds as buzzing, hissing, sanding, etc., and even different tinnitus may be heard in different time periods of the same person’s day.

Misunderstanding 7. Wearing hearing aids is not helpful for tinnitus

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
In fact, wearing a hearing aid can amplify the sound of the external environment, so as to mask tinnitus and relieve the symptoms of tinnitus.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
In addition, a large number of hearing aids have the function of tinnitus masking, which can help more tinnitus patients with hearing loss to some extent.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Mistake 8: taking medicine can cure tinnitus

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Unfortunately, there is no “panacea” to cure tinnitus. But there are some treatments that can reduce the symptoms of tinnitus and make it easier for us to accept tinnitus. For example, in the field of acoustic therapy, great success has been achieved. By playing masking noise similar to tinnitus tone, the perception of tinnitus can be slowed down.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
For example, tinnitus acclimatization therapy, meditation, psychotherapy, cognitive behavior therapy, as well as changing diet and strengthening physical exercise can also control tinnitus to a certain extent.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
Of course, tinnitus may not be “eliminated” by a single method. It usually needs several methods. It is recommended to consult a professional otologist for symptomatic treatment.

No loud, no tinnitus with earplugs

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
If you are a music enthusiast, listen to high volume music for a long time, or your work environment has high-intensity noise, these may cause tinnitus. So, it’s good for ears to try to avoid these noisy environments.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
However, the causes of tinnitus are various. People of different ages, races, health conditions and socio-economic backgrounds may have tinnitus, and there is usually no clear reason.

< P style = "color:; font family: Arial, Verdana, sans serif;" >
In other words, even if you don’t listen to loud music and use earplugs to protect your hearing in noisy environments, that doesn’t mean you can avoid tinnitus.
